diff options
-rwxr-xr-x | src/tools/pgindent/pgindent |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/src/tools/pgindent/pgindent b/src/tools/pgindent/pgindent index 15f30e6a30f..d5e99913ebc 100755 --- a/src/tools/pgindent/pgindent +++ b/src/tools/pgindent/pgindent @@ -1492,9 +1492,9 @@ do line2 = line3; } END { - if (NR > 1 && skips <= 1) + if (NR >= 2 && skips <= 1) print line1; - if (NR > 2 && skips <= 2) + if (NR >= 1 && skips <= 2) print line2; }' | # remove blank line between opening brace and block comment @@ -1520,9 +1520,9 @@ do line2 = line3; } END { - if (NR > 1 && skips <= 1) + if (NR >= 2 && skips <= 1) print line1; - if (NR > 2 && skips <= 2) + if (NR >= 1 && skips <= 2) print line2; }' | # remove blank line before #endif @@ -1544,7 +1544,7 @@ do line1 = line2; } END { - if (NR > 1 && skips <= 1) + if (NR >= 1 && skips <= 1) print line1; }' | # add blank line before #endif if it is the last line in the file @@ -1556,7 +1556,7 @@ do line1 = line2; } END { - if (NR > 1 && line2 ~ "^#endif") + if (NR >= 1 && line2 ~ "^#endif") printf "\n"; print line1; }' | |